Our school is committed to providing our students with an integral development of the spiritual, moral, intellectual, physical, social, and aesthetic aspects, and a holistic education in accordance with the principles and the spirit of Christian Education. We hope our students live up to the school motto, 'Not To Be Served But To Serve', and they can gain a solid foundation, love and serve our community, our country and our world with dedication.

Mode Of Teaching

Mode of teaching at different levels Small class teaching and learning is adopted from Primary One to Primary Six. In order to cater for students' needs and learning diversity, co-operative learning and small group learning are carried out.
Class Remarks -
Number of test(s) per year 0
Number of exam(s) per year 3
Diversified Assessment for Learning The school is developing diversified formative assessment for learning including self-assessment and peer assessment (including project learning, activities and moral education).
Streaming arrangement From P.3 to P.6, based on students' learning ability.
